Re: [Xen-devel] [PATCH] ioemu: drop unused 4MB video memory



Hello,

Ian Jackson, le Mon 14 Jul 2008 10:35:15 +0100, a écrit :
> Samuel Thibault writes ("[Xen-devel] [PATCH] ioemu: drop unused 4MB video 
> memory"):
> > ioemu: drop unused 4MB video memory
> > 
> > Since we only emulate the cirrus VGA video card which is only able to
> > expose 4MB video memory, we don't need more than that.
> 
> I see this has gone into xen-unstable and also the new qemu-xen tree[1].
> 
> But it would be nice to understand the compatibility properties:
>  * Evidently it breaks when tools have this change but qemu-dm
>    doesn't.

Yes.

> Is there a way to avoid this being a fatal error ?

Unfortunately VGA_RAM_SIZE is used in a lot of places of qemu so that'd
be a bit hard.

>  * I think I'm correct to assume that this change is harmless for
>    a new qemu-dm and old tools ?

Yes.

>  * What about save/restore ?

Ah, right, we need a compatibility version for that, I'll work on it.
